Subject: Key rotation for InvoiceForge renderer

Welcome, new folks. Every quarter we rotate the credential the Pellworth PDF invoice renderer uses to call our internal asset service, Vaultline. The old key stops working Friday at noon. Update your local .env and the staging config before then, and verify a test invoice renders with the new embedded fonts. For convenience, the freshly issued key is included here.

app token of bagef-bageg = kto11_vuwA0uhrEMg

Q: How does DeployDrake, the deploy-status chat bot, handle lost credentials? A: DeployDrake authenticates against the Quillbank token service. Tokens rotate every 24 hours automatically. If rotation fails and the bot account locks, deploy status queries return errors until recovery completes. Recovery requires an admin to trigger the reset flow, confirm the bot identity, and supply the stored passphrase. No other bypass exists; this is intentional. The recovery passphrase is recorded directly below.

unlock words, kajef-kadug: sorys-pelax-lamael-tamvan-briiel-novdor-fenwyn-tamdor-oliion-keleth-julok-belion-ralok

Load testing the Cartwheel checkout flow: always run against the `perf-stage` environment, never production, and warm the payment-stub cache for ten minutes before ramping. Ramp in three steps — 100, 500, then 1500 virtual shoppers — holding each for fifteen minutes. Abort if p99 latency exceeds two seconds. Target rates, abort thresholds, and dashboards are described on the internal page.

dashboard of bafof-hafog = https://confluence.lumiclabs.internal/display/browse/display/6a09a20a

Capacity note for the Bramblewick export retry queue. Failed exports are requeued with exponential backoff, and the queue depth is our main capacity signal: sustained depth above the high-water mark means downstream Pellis storage is saturated, not that we need more workers. As the new contractor, please don't raise worker counts without checking storage latency first — it usually makes things worse. Retry timing, backoff caps, and the high-water threshold are all driven by the constants shown below.

limits module of yagef-bajog:
TIERS = {
    "druael": 370,
    "tamix": 286,
    "pelius": 541,
    "pelael": 78,
    "pelox": 47,
    "ralath": 533,
    "drumir": 801,
}